Big-hearted, open-hearted, warm-hearted, take your pick: whatever its other attributes, Carlo Maria Giulini's 1975 recording of Beethoven's Missa Solemnis with the London Philharmonic Orchestra & Chorus has a heart as big as all outdoors. Under Giulini's tender hands, the Missa Solemnis is above all else a lyrical work, a work where every line sings and every instrument is a voice. One gets the sense that Giulini loves every note and every musician and every moment of the performance, and his affection transforms his Missa Solemnis into a festival of love. This is, of course, a good thing and pretty much what Beethoven was driving at when he said of the Missa Solemnis that it "comes from the heart," but love is not all there is to the work. And while Giulini's Missa Solemnis has a lot of heart, it doesn't have much else going for it. Which is not to say that it is not superbly sung and played; Giulini's British musicians give him their best. It is to say that the work is not all there. The profound soulfulness, the transcendent spirituality, the overwhelming sense that the numinous is imminent: all of it and everything is drowned in Giulini's sea of love. As heartfelt as Giulini's is, stick with Otto Klemperer's 1965 recording, one of the most sublime recordings ever made. EMI's stereo sound was a little dim and distant in its day and the digital remastering is only a little better.
